Night Constructionby NikonJebComment: I'll give it a whirl - I guess the first thing that strikes me is that it makes me wonder if I am still feeling the effects of my celebratory Frday night cocktails. That said, I think I am not, and the picture would benefit from a more horizontal orientation and crop. But I like, very much, the way I am drawn to the well-lit center of the photo, but then I am distracted by the crane overhead. I also feel like the building on the left is obtrusive, cutting off the scene I am trying to see. Maybe that's a good thing - creates some tension for hte viewer. I like the theme of the photo - the surprise of the activity in what I feel is a dark, quiet, empty street.
